00:00Court of Appeal President Abang Iskandar Abang Hashim appears likely to helm the judiciary
00:06as the next Chief Justice, with incumbent Tengku Maimun Tuan Mat set to retire in June,
00:12according to a source.
00:14If appointed, Abang Iskandar, the current holder of the judiciary's second-most senior
00:18position, will become the first judge from Sarawak to reach its pinnacle.
00:23The source said the appointment appears to be strategic as there is presently no other
00:27Sarawakian who is likely to come close to being made top judge in the near future.
00:33Abang Iskandar will reach the mandatory retirement age for judges on July 1, but is expected
00:38to receive a six-month extension to his tenure from the Yang di-Pertuan Agong.
00:44The source also said newly-installed federal court judge Ahmad Teri Rudin Saleh is the
00:49frontrunner to replace Abang Iskandar as Court of Appeal President.
00:54Under the law, the Judicial Appointments Commission is required to send a list of
00:57candidates for the top post to the Prime Minister, who will, in accordance with Article 122B
01:03of the Constitution, tender his advice to the King.
01:07The article also requires the King to act on the Prime Minister's advice after consultation
01:12with the Conference of Rulers.
